My Cloud Home is an easy-to-use personal storage device that plugs directly into your Wi-Fi router at home so you can save all your digital content in one central place. Back up the photos and videos on your phone, and wirelessly back up and sync all your PC and Mac computers and cloud accounts.

Specifications
Model |
|
---|---|
Brand | Western Digital
|
Model | My Cloud Home 4 TB
|
Part Number | WDBVXC0040HWT-NESN
|
Color | White |
Type | NAS Server |
General Specifications |
|
Capacity | 4 TB |
Interface | 1x RJ-45, 2x USB-A 3.0 |
Drive Bays | 2x 3.5" SATA |
Operating Temperature | 5C to 35C |
Non-Operating Temperature | -20C to 65C |
System Requirements | Windows 10 or 8.1 operating systems Mac OS Catalina, Mojave or High Sierra For mobile: iOS 11+ and Android 4.4+ Router and internet connection |
Processor | ARM Cortex-A57 |
Memory | 2GB DDR3 |
Security | 256-Bit AES |
Physical Specifications |
|
Dimensions(cm) | 175.5 x 140 x 53 mm
|
Weight | 1.05 Kg
|
Features |
|
Features | One central place to store and organize everything
Quick and simple setup Mobile, on-the-go access Backup for photos and videos on your phone USB port to import photos and videos from external storage devices File search to find content easily |
Included in Package |
|
Included in Package | Personal cloud storage
Ethernet cable AC adapter Quick Install Guide |
